"Ely! You've seriously got to change that voice mail thingy! I mean you bothered to change the security lock number but you can't change that?" Nina's voice rang through the apartment but didn't reach Elena's mind.
"Okay! I know that sounded like a bitchy stuff but come on, I'm right outside this stupid door and I can't even get in! Come on Ely... come open the door! I know you haven't gone anywhere since last week so... OPEN THE DOOR!" Nina didn't even try to quite down.
At the last word, Ely's shook out of her thoughts to present.
"Nina?" her own voice sounded so hoarse to herself.
She cleared her throat and began to get out of her bed as Nina continued to ramble on and on.
"Okay! You don't have to come all the way to the door... just pick up the phone and whisper the magic numbers honey!" she pleaded.
Ely opened the door to her best friend. She didn't need to invite her in; she was already inside the apartment, hugging her into a tight and much-needed embrace.
No words were necessary to be spoken; Elena got all the comfort in the world just by that silent gesture. They stayed in that position for a while and at the beginning, Ely tried to fight it but gradually she gave in. She let her head fall into Nina's shoulder and wept like she had never wept before, like a grieved child, like a love-lost teenager that she actually was.
"Shh-shh... shh..." Nina rocked her sad friend and gently tapped her back trying to get her friend to relax a bit.
"He hasn't called yet Nina! He hasn't... he ... he "Ely stammered through her choked up voice.
"It's okay Ely... it's okay"
"No it's not Nina... it's all, my fault! Everything is my fault. And now I'm alone and he doesn't call... his phone is switched off... he doesn't return any of my voice mail, he's not like that. You know him. He could never go on a day without calling me, and it has been 3 weeks Nina. 3 damn weeks. What.... What should I do? What am I gonna do now Nina? What..." Ely wept bitterly once again.
Nina pulled her best-friend to the sofa and made her sit there.
"Okay... first up, you are not alone , I'm always here for you! And second... it's not your fault Ely. I can't say if it's Evan's fault or not, but it definitely isn't your fault."
Elena denied answering to that. She couldn't find it in her to utter the correct words for anything at the moment anymore.
During that time, Nina went outside and brought four fully loaded bags, all the stuff that Ely needed at the moment and all the stuff that she had ogled up in those days she spent isolated from the society, it was all there in those bags.
Ely watched her best friend as she filled up her fridge and started cleaning up. Ely smiled remembering what Evan used to call her.
"Bossy"
That name suited her best. Nina could get really bossy if she thought she wanted things her way, but it was all the more reason she loved her.
Ely slowly stood up and walked to the kitchen to help her 'Bossy' best friend.
"No!" Nina ordered.
"You go clean yourself up! I need that silky hair back in 15 minutes" she exclaimed.
Unconsciously or consciously Elena moved her hand to her hair. She expected to touch something soft and silky as she was used to but all she found was hair that could easily be mistaken for a broom's end! It was messy, rough and very... very much in the need of a shampoo and a conditioner.
Ely felt ashamed of herself. She was dressed in the same pair of pajamas that she wore... gee... she didn't even remember when she last wore that pajamas or better yet changed them. She touched her skin, it was well... it was different and her eyes were sore and she knew they had found a new companion in those evident dark circles. She eyed her black-edged nails, half jagged edged coz of her own new habit of chewing them off.
And Ely's another new habit showed up round the corner! Her tears were her new habit. As she judged herself disgusting, new set of tears fell across her cheeks.
"Oh c'mon Ely... it's not like I haven't seen you in a mess or something. We've grown up together and you don't need to feel ashamed of being in a mess right now! Coz you're gonna get out of this mess today, since I'm finally here to clean it up! Better late than never so go and get your hair that conditioner!"
Elena sniffed and rubbed her tears away as she put on a small smile in her face and whispered "okay" and she went for the shower that she should have taken weeks ago!
When Elena came out of the bathroom after 45 minutes, the apartment seemed cleaner and weird. All the wrappers and dirty stuff that her eyes had grown accustomed to were gone and outside the apartment were two huge plastic bags full of it.
Ely searched for Nina, and found her just outside the kitchen trying to pick out the wall of the pictures of Ev-ena's memory ride as Nina used to call it.
"NO!" Elena shrieked as she caught Nina's right arm trying to grab the pictures out.
"Ely? What's the matter? I thought...."
"No... don't take them off. "Elena whispered feeling so embarrassed of her helplessness.
"But why? You don't have to torture yourself by looking at those pictures all the time Ely!"
"I don't... I mean... I don't look at them all the time Nina..." she confessed.
"So?" Nina asked gently.
"Just... please." was all Elena could muster up to say.
Nina held Ely's hand encouraging her to speak.
"If you take those pictures off... this place..." she took a ragged breath in "this place will not be my home. This place... doesn't feel like my home any more Nina and the only thing left that seems... that confirms that those 2 years weren't the creation of my hallucination are those... those pictures right there. And I can't... I don't have the strength to part with them yet."
Elena bent her head down and started to nibble her nails again. Nina trying to change the mood said, "Okay! Let them be there for a while. But for now, let's get those nails done! I brought cherry red and black ... which one do you wanna wear?"
"Umm... both! First black then red!" Ely cheered up a bit pushing her new habit away for the moment.
"Great choice I must say" Nina made a face.
They both laughed and caught up on what Nina did for the last month. Nina provided Ely with all the latest gossip about their high school friends who had been out of touch. Suddenly Nina exclaimed taking Ely by surprise.
"Oh yeah, I almost forgot! Your classes at the university start after this weekend!"
"University? Huh? What are you talking about?"
"D'oh! Dude your college!"
"I know what university means! But class? What the hell are you talking about?"
"Well... I thought you knew... Mrs. Parker appointed you to spring classes... that are from Monday." Nina explained slowly.
"Mrs. Parker? Mom? Rachel? Why would she do that?"
"Well I might have filled her head a little bit" Nina confessed rather goofily.
"Filled her head? NINA!! What the hell did you say? Why the hell did you say it? What did you do?" Ely was shocked.
"Well I wanted to go to college with my best friend!" Nina made a face as if it were the most obvious reason in the world!
"NINA!!!" Elena shrieked.
